Along with elbows, carbon steel pipe fittings additionally consist of tees, which attach 3 areas of pipe, producing junctions for fluid circulation. Equal tees are made use of when the linking branches are of the exact same diameter, while reducing tees are used when the branch pipe is of a smaller sized diameter. Carbon steel fittings, especially those fabricated with seamless processes, are wanted for their uniformity and high toughness. These seamless fittings are produced without any kind of welds or joints, making them ideal for high-pressure applications where architectural integrity is important.

For service providers and home builders, comprehending the specifications and applications of these numerous fittings is necessary. Carbon steel pipe fittings, particularly, must be selected based on factors such as the liquid being transferred, stress demands, temperature factors to consider, and the environment in which the piping will certainly operate. In addition to common fittings, pipe bends add an additional layer of flexibility to piping systems. Criterion bends, such as 90-degree bends, are essential to routing flow without sharp corners that can hinder efficiency. For applications requiring progressive changes, 5D bends and 3D bends are perfect, using smoother changes in direction to lessen stress loss. Along with typical carbon steel fittings, stainless-steel fittings are increasingly being used in applications that require additional resistance to corrosion and higher aesthetic appeal. Stainless fittings, while typically much more expensive than carbon steel options, offer unique benefits in specific environments where direct exposure to the components or harsh materials is a worry. Flanges, including kinds such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), offer as crucial parts in piping systems. Carbon steel flanges are specifically preferred due to their toughness and cost-effectiveness.

Moreover, while carbon steel fittings are common due to their cost-effectiveness, the range of stainless-steel fittings can not be ignored. Stainless-steel fittings boast phenomenal corrosion resistance, making them vital in food processing, chemical manufacturing, and aquatic applications. Their resilience enables them to grow in environments that would or else lead to rapid deterioration of carbon steel choices.

The selection in between carbon steel and stainless-steel fittings eventually comes down to the particular requirements of the application, taking into consideration elements like temperature, pressure, and the kind of liquids being moved. Applications including corrosive materials might necessitate the usage of stainless steel elbows and tees, while carbon steel choices would be extra economically feasible for less requiring atmospheres.
